    I purchased three Engenius 9550 devices all connected to my switch via PoE. The wireless for each works really well with a strong signal all connecting back to the switch then out to the internet.

    Each has it's own fixed IP address.

    My question is how do I give my users a seemless wireless experience with all three devices no matter where they are in the building? I have seen WDS but that weems to suggest that only one of the devices should be connected to the switch.

    Seamless roaming is called IEE 802.11r (r for rapid) and NOTHING supports this. For 802.11r to work the APs and your clients (PCs etc..) would have to support this and, I'm afraid, nothing does. WDS is really just all repeaters with one unit connected to the LAN. It's not roaming. The big problem is the client which will only decide to switch AP when the signal to the first AP has broken. i.e. not seamless.
